Michael Caruso and I met in New York while I was recording my first album with Sunrise. Michael was a guest of band founder
Rick Rydell, and was soon in the band. We played a million nightclubs together, drove across country twice in rickety trucks,
were signed to managers and record labels together, and did a lot of songwriting together!
Our first songwriter adventures were somewhat naive, yet produced results ... We simply hopped on the train from Philly
to New York, slept on friends' floors, and roamed the streets of Manhattan with a guitar ... braving our way into anyone's
office we could, and playing our songs live for anyone who would listen. Ha! No guts, no glory!
We managed to interest a few music biz people ... Mercury Records invited us to do some demos in their NY studios ...
we met a publisher who later offered to have our song 'Say It' recorded by the Neville Brothers ... a few others. Michael
and I also played a few small clubs in Manhattan, just for fun.
When our band landed in L.A. and rented a house with a piano, Michael and I played 'grown up songwriters' and wrote songs
every day for a few weeks ... as though it was our job. We wrote a bunch of songs ... a few of which were quite good!
Michael later realized that dream ... he has been signed to several songwriting/publishing deals. Good for him! The
first significant 'cover' I recall for Michael was Joan Jett's recording of 'Long Live The Night' (co-written by Joan Jett
& Randy Cantor), which appeared in the movie 'Days Of Thunder.' Perhaps more notable was 'Love Is' (co-written with John
Keller & Tonio K.) recorded by Vanessa Williams & Brian McKnight.
